Job Description

Description Job Title:
Repair Technician Do you have mechanical aptitude? Are you a skilled repair technician? Are you a motivated team player and looking for an employee-focused company to build a successful, long-term career? Do you like to travel and meet new people? If so, please read on! At Midwest Valve Services, a Novaspect company, our employees are our most important asset. To illustrate, we offer the following benefits:
Repair Technician Benefits:
Starting pay: $24-34 per hour. Additional compensation will be paid for any travel and fieldwork. Generous paid time off - 15 vacation days, 10 paid holidays, and 10 sick days 6% match on your 401K Employee Stock Ownership Program (ESOP) on first day of employment Great health benefits Student debt reimbursement
Repair Technician Duties and Responsibilities:
Participate in the repair, testing, calibration and troubleshooting of industrial valves. Training will be provided. Verify measurements, calculate dimensions and verify tolerances. Complete valve repair and service reports. Rigging and hoisting valve and actuator components in compliance with OSHA standards. Travel, including overnights, as required throughout service territory via company vehicle. Other duties as required. •The final offer will be based on several factors, including, but not limited to the candidates depth of experience, skill set, qualifications, and internal pay equity. Hiring at the top end of the range would not be typical, to allow for future meaningful salary growth in the position.
Requirements Repair Technician Qualifications and Requirements:
High school diploma or GED A valid driver's license and ability to be insured on company insurance Ability to meet physical requirements, including passing a DOT physical Must have legible writing, math and measurement skills
